Although Chen Pi infusion has the effect of relieving cough, food accumulation and stomach pain, it also has certain contraindications, such as constipation patients will have side effects on the body after drinking it. The main reason is that although Chen Pi is a pungent, bitter and warm Chinese medicine herb, it also has certain dryness characteristics, which can aggravate the real heat in the body and cause severe constipation when consumed by constipated patients. In addition, the following groups of people are not recommended to drink Chen Pi infusion: 1, pregnant women: If pregnant women have a deficient qi body dry or yin deficiency dry cough, after drinking Chen Pi infusion will aggravate the yin deficiency, and then there are obvious palpitations and shortness of breath, dizziness, poor mental state and other discomfort; 2, people with excessive stomach acid: this group of people often accompanied by loss of appetite, nausea, acid reflux, heartburn and other uncomfortable symptoms, mainly due to stomach fire, qi deficiency caused by. At this time, drinking Chen Pi infusion will increase the secretion of gastric acid; 3, some people taking western medicine: during the taking of calcium carbonate, magnesium sulfate, ferrous sulfate, aluminum hydroxide, bismuth carbonate and other western medicine, it is not recommended to use Chen Pi infusion. Because the peel contains flavonoids, will affect the absorption of western drugs. In addition, Chen Pi infused water should not be used at the same time with Toltrazurin, phenibut and other alpha-blockers to avoid certain effects on the antihypertensive effect.
